Arsenal are reportedly preparing to trigger Nico Williams' €58 million release clause as they look to strengthen their attack ahead of the new season. The Athletic Club winger has impressed in La Liga and Euro 2024, making him a prime target for Mikel Arteta.
Arsenal’s Interest in Nico Williams
- The Gunners are seeking attacking reinforcements following injuries to Bukayo Saka and Kai Havertz.
- With Gabriel Jesus sidelined and Leandro Trossard’s future uncertain, Arsenal may sign multiple forwards.
- Nico Williams is currently ranked among the top left-wingers globally and can operate on either flank.
Transfer Details & Financial Considerations
- Arsenal have held discussions with the 22-year-old Spanish international’s representatives.
- The €58 million release clause must be paid in full, rather than in installments.
- Williams earns a reported €200,000 per week, which would place him among Arsenal’s top earners.
Will Arsenal Complete the Signing?
- Arsenal previously opted against high-priced La Liga signings, such as Alexander Isak in 2022.
- While Williams offers pace and versatility, Arsenal may explore cost-effective alternatives like Bournemouth’s Antoine Semenyo.
- According to Transfermarkt, Williams is valued at €70 million, making him a significant investment.
